Lam Tin station
Lam Tin is a station on the Hong Kong MTR Kwun Tong line built as a part of the extension to Quarry Bay. The station is linked to the nearby hillside community of Lam Tin by a series of escalators.Photo: Qwer132477, CC BY-SA 3.0.

Sceneway Plaza
Shopping center
Photo: WiNG,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Hong Kong Sceneway Plaza is a shopping centre in Lam Tin, Kowloon, Hong Kong. It also contains the East Kowloon Office of the Immigration Department. Opened in February 1992, the shopping centre is located adjacent to Lam Tin station of Hong Kong's Mass Transit Railway.
Sceneway Garden
Residential area
Photo: WiNG,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Sceneway Garden is a private housing estate in Lam Tin, Hong Kong, built by Cheung Kong Holdings, and completed in 1992. Sceneway Garden is one of the few dog-friendly and pet-friendly private housing estates in Hong Kong, with a large open space for recreation that is suitable for exercising dogs.

Cha Kwo Ling
Suburb
Photo: Mk2010,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Cha Kwo Ling is a hill in the eastern New Kowloon area of Hong Kong, and the area around it. It is adjacent to Victoria Harbour and located to the west of Yau Tong and southwest of Lam Tin.
Kwun Tong
Suburb
Photo: Wing1990hk, CC BY 3.0.
Kwun Tong is an area in the Kwun Tong District of Hong Kong, situated at the eastern part of the Kowloon Peninsula, and its boundary stretches from Lion Rock in the north to Lei Yue Mun in the south, and from the winding paths of Kowloon Peak in the east to the north coast of the former Kai Tak Airport runway in the west.
Yau Tong
Suburb
Photo: Nhk9,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Yau Tong is an area of Hong Kong, located in the southeastern end of Kowloon, between Lei Yue Mun and Lam Tin, at the east shore of Victoria Harbour, west of Tseung Kwan O.
